Barrel clay tiles have a distinctive rounded shape, often resembling the form of a half-cylinder. This design allows for efficient water drainage, making them particularly effective in regions prone to heavy rainfall. Their overlapping arrangement not only enhances water management but also provides a visually appealing undulating effect on rooftops. Regular inspections should be a priority, focusing on signs of wear, cracks, or deterioration. Keeping your flaunching clean and free from debris, such as leaves and twigs, prevents water from pooling and causing damage. Applying a waterproof sealant can also provide an extra layer of protection against the elements, reducing the risk of moisture-related issues.

Water should be directed away from the chimney structure to prevent it from seeping into the flaunching and causing erosion. Installing gutter systems and downspouts can help manage rainwater effectively. Establishing a routine maintenance schedule will ensure any potential problems are identified early, allowing for timely interventions that can save both time and money in the long run.

Homeowners should look for visible cracks, gaps, or any loose materials around the chimney cap. Cleaning debris from the chimney crown helps prevent moisture accumulation. This moisture can weaken the flaunching over time, leading to more extensive repairs. Ensuring that the surrounding roof area is clear of overhanging branches or foliage also supports the longevity of the flaunching.
